I have been reading in the post about the CTC art supplies and just wanted to share something. I went to the "miller pads and paper" website and after calling the local craft store, figured it was the best deal to just order from them since I live in WI and the shipping is cheaper. In looking, I found that the flat brushes are on sale for $2.00 and the palette for $2.50. At least I believe they are on sale, since the prices are in red and are less than the stated prices in the item description. So, just an fyi to those of us in need of the supplies!

Also, I ordered the 4 needed brushes, 3 packs of the #120 paper, the pallette, and the Niji 18 color tubes of paint all for $31.00 plus shipping. They are contacting me to let me know the shipping, probably tomorrow, if anyone is interested. Not too bad they say since it qualifies for SPEEDEE shipping. :)
